Basic Concept of Line-of-Sight
Line-of-sight in XCOM 2 is based on the visibility between two points on the map, typically between a soldier and an enemy unit. A clear line-of-sight means that there are no obstacles blocking the view between the two points, allowing the soldier to target the enemy. However, if there are obstructions in the way, such as walls, cover objects, or environmental elements, the line-of-sight is blocked, and the soldier cannot see or target the enemy unit behind the obstruction.
Factors Affecting Line-of-Sight
Several factors can affect the line-of-sight mechanic in XCOM 2. The most obvious factor is the presence of cover objects on the battlefield, such as walls, buildings, vehicles, and other environmental elements. These obstacles can block the line-of-sight between two units, requiring players to maneuver their soldiers into better positions to gain a clear shot at the enemy.
Another important factor is elevation. Soldiers positioned on higher ground have better line-of-sight and can see and target enemies that are at lower elevations more easily. Elevation can provide a significant advantage in combat, allowing players to engage enemies from a distance while remaining relatively safe from return fire.
Additionally, certain battlefield conditions or environmental effects can also affect line-of-sight. For example, smoke grenades or other forms of concealment can partially obscure vision, making it harder for soldiers to maintain a clear line-of-sight to their targets. Use of Cover and Concealment
In XCOM 2, players must strategically utilize cover and concealment to maximize their soldiers' line-of-sight and minimize their exposure to enemy fire. Cover objects, such as walls or cars, can provide protection from enemy attacks and also influence the line-of-sight between units. By using cover effectively, players can block the enemy's line-of-sight to their soldiers while maintaining their own ability to target and engage the enemy.
Concealment, on the other hand, can be used to surprise enemies and gain a tactical advantage. Soldiers that are concealed are not immediately visible to enemy units, allowing players to position their troops strategically without alerting the enemy. This can be especially useful for setting up ambushes or flanking maneuvers where the element of surprise can be decisive in securing victory.
Advanced Line-of-Sight Tactics
As players progress through XCOM 2, they can discover and employ more advanced tactics to manipulate the line-of-sight mechanic to their advantage. One common tactic is "peeking," where players move their soldiers to the edge of a piece of cover to gain line-of-sight to an enemy without fully exposing themselves to return fire. This allows players to scout enemy positions and plan their moves more effectively.
Another tactic is "fog of war manipulation," where players intentionally break line-of-sight with enemies to force them to move and reveal their positions. By using this tactic strategically, players can lure enemies into traps or create opportunities for flanking maneuvers to take out high-value targets.
Players can also use explosives to remove cover objects or obstacles that are blocking their line-of-sight to enemies. By strategically placing explosives and destroying cover, players can open up new lines of sight and create opportunities for their soldiers to target and eliminate enemy units more effectively.
